Just added:

Alex Wollschlaeger, Offensive Lineman - Bowling Green: Wollschlaeger is an experienced, three year starter at Bowling Green along the Falcons' offensive front. Throughout his time at Bowling Green, Wollschlaeger started pretty much exclusively at right tackle. This past season, he was a first team All-MAC selection, just a year after being named third team All-MAC. Wollschlaeger has one year of eligibility remaining. Per source, Wollschlaeger is expected to visit Indiana on Friday, Dec. 13.

247 has him as a 4* transfer and #2 OL (33 overall) in the portal
